Lines Matching refs:rx_desc
1860 struct ixgb_rx_desc *rx_desc, in ixgb_rx_checksum() argument
1866 if ((rx_desc->status & IXGB_RX_DESC_STATUS_IXSM) || in ixgb_rx_checksum()
1867 (!(rx_desc->status & IXGB_RX_DESC_STATUS_TCPCS))) { in ixgb_rx_checksum()
1874 if (rx_desc->errors & IXGB_RX_DESC_ERRORS_TCPE) { in ixgb_rx_checksum()
1896 struct ixgb_rx_desc *rx_desc, *next_rxd; in ixgb_clean_rx_irq() local
1904 rx_desc = IXGB_RX_DESC(*rx_ring, i); in ixgb_clean_rx_irq()
1907 while (rx_desc->status & IXGB_RX_DESC_STATUS_DD) { in ixgb_clean_rx_irq()
1915 status = rx_desc->status; in ixgb_clean_rx_irq()
1940 length = le16_to_cpu(rx_desc->length); in ixgb_clean_rx_irq()
1941 rx_desc->length = 0; in ixgb_clean_rx_irq()
1954 if (unlikely(rx_desc->errors & in ixgb_clean_rx_irq()
1986 ixgb_rx_checksum(adapter, rx_desc, skb); in ixgb_clean_rx_irq()
1991 le16_to_cpu(rx_desc->special)); in ixgb_clean_rx_irq()
1998 rx_desc->status = 0; in ixgb_clean_rx_irq()
2007 rx_desc = next_rxd; in ixgb_clean_rx_irq()
2031 struct ixgb_rx_desc *rx_desc; in ixgb_alloc_rx_buffers() local
2073 rx_desc = IXGB_RX_DESC(*rx_ring, i); in ixgb_alloc_rx_buffers()
2074 rx_desc->buff_addr = cpu_to_le64(buffer_info->dma); in ixgb_alloc_rx_buffers()
2078 rx_desc->status = 0; in ixgb_alloc_rx_buffers()